1872 Commercial Dollar, Copper Pattern Dollar PR J-1213a Values

Details

1872 Commercial Dollar This should be light in weight. ex: Woodside where it was described as silver plated.

Obverse: Longacre’s Indian Princess design, 13 stars around, 22 stars on the flag, without name below base, as first used posthumously in 1870 (cf. J-1008).

Reverse: Commercial dollar die as first used in 1871.
